Today is the day! The day we’ve all been waiting for. The 11th annual quilt show opens today. It’s a two day show, so you can swing by today from 10 am – 4 pm or tomorrow from 10 am – 3 pm.

The quilts and items above in the slideshow are just some of the beautiful works of art we are displaying in this year’s “Annual Challenge.” Every year we select one fabric and each of the Pine Needlers makes something of their own choosing. And this year we’ve turned out a bounty of unique and amazing things.

2015 raffle quiltAnd there is still a chance to purchase raffle tickets to this years stunning Pine Needler raffle quilt. The quilt will be raffled off tomorrow at about 5 pm, so make sure to buy some tickets so you have a chance to win it. If you don’t buy tickets, you won’t have ANY chance at all. Where’s the fun in that? And remember, all the proceeds go toward the town of Lowell: food pantry, library, firehall, etc. All good causes. The Pine Needlers work hard all year long to make this raffle quilt and show happen and we’d love to have you drop by.

Where? Lowell Grange Hall on 2nd Street in Lowell.

The 11th annual quilt show is just days away now. So exciting! A lot of people have put in a lot of time over the past year to make this happen. The Lowell Pine Needlers are a hearty group of ladies who make this show happen. And there are supporting friends and husbands and townsfolk that contribute as well. A big thank you to all of you!

The show is held in the Lowell Grange Hall on Saturday and Sunday, July 25-26, 2015. And guess what? There is air-conditioning in the Grange! That’s pretty tempting, right? And while you are browsing the quilts, and voting in our “People’s Choice” awards, you can also purchase a few raffle tickets and get in on the chance to win this year’s stunning raffle quilt.2015 Pine Needlers Raffle Quilt

All the money the Pine Needlers raise goes back into the town of Lowell in one way or another. Last year we supported the good works of the Lowell Library, the Firehall, and the Food Bank just to name a few. So your dollars go for good causes. And thank you for your support.

The quilt show is FREE as well, and each year the ladies work hard to give the community a spectacular display of quilts. Each year is different. Each year is stunning. So I hope you can come by the Grange Hall and check it out.

The Pine Needlers are excited to announce that there will be official judges for particular categories in the 2014 Blackberry Jam Quilt Show. So in addition to the people’s choice awards which we have sponsored for the past few years, in this, our 10th year, we will have a few categories that will be judged by our new official quilting judges! We are thrilled to have the talent of:

Becky Fetrow of Piece by Piece Fabrics in Eugene

Helen Andrews of The Quilt Patch in Eugene

Jeanette Singler of Country Bumpkin Quilt Store in Eugene

Kennette Blotzer of Something to Crow About in Springfield

A big thank you to each of you for participating in our show in this way! Winners will be announced on the quilt show website by mid-August.

This years show will be held July 26-27, 2014 in the Lowell Grange Hall.
